Facility Overview

Level(3) Oakland operates as a strategic colocation facility in Emeryville, California, owned and managed by Lumen Technologies Inc. This data center serves as part of Lumen's extensive North American infrastructure network, positioning itself as a key connectivity hub in the San Francisco Bay Area market. The facility provides colocation services to enterprises, cloud providers, and service providers seeking reliable infrastructure with proximity to major West Coast technology corridors.

The data center benefits from its location within the broader San Francisco Bay Area ecosystem, offering tenants access to one of the most connected metropolitan regions on the West Coast. As part of Lumen's portfolio, the facility leverages the provider's experience in delivering enterprise-grade infrastructure services and maintaining carrier-neutral environments that support diverse connectivity requirements.

About Colocation in Emeryville

Emeryville Data Center Market

Emeryville occupies a strategic position within the San Francisco Bay Area colocation market, serving as an attractive alternative to higher-cost San Francisco and San Jose markets while maintaining excellent connectivity to both regions. The city's location between San Francisco and Oakland provides data center operators with access to diverse fiber routes and network infrastructure while offering more favorable real estate economics than core metropolitan areas.

The broader Bay Area market benefits from its role as a major internet traffic hub, with multiple submarine cable landings connecting North America to Asia-Pacific regions. This geography creates strong demand for colocation services from enterprises, cloud providers, and content companies that need to optimize performance for both domestic and international traffic flows.
